Sarajevo / Bosnia : At the Ministry of Defense of Bosnia and Herzegovina, Minister Zukan Helez welcomed a delegation from the National Defence University (NDU) of the Islamic Republic of Pakistan.
The delegation was led by Brigadier General Bakhti Baidar Wali Lone of the Pakistani Armed Forces, accompanied by the Ambassador of Pakistan to Bosnia and Herzegovina, retired Major General Syed Qaiser Abbas Shah.
At the outset of the meeting, Minister Helez expressed solidarity and sympathy with the Pakistani delegation following the recent attack by India on the sovereign territory of Pakistan.
He also conveyed his gratitude to Pakistan’s Ambassador to the United Nations for his address at the UN Security Council session the previous day, in which he urged firm action against the RS entity authorities for their secessionist actions and voiced strong support for Bosnia and Herzegovina and its institutions.
Minister Helez reaffirmed that the Islamic Republic of Pakistan remains a valued and steadfast partner to Bosnia and Herzegovina, consistently upholding its sovereignty, territorial integrity, and national unity.
During the meeting, the Minister briefed the Pakistani delegation on the organizational structure, responsibilities, and current condition of the Ministry of Defense and the Armed Forces of Bosnia and Herzegovina.
He highlighted the long-standing and productive partnership between the two countries, particularly in the defense industry and the training of Armed Forces personnel. Discussions also focused on identifying new avenues to deepen and expand this cooperation further.
